The cost of equipment designed to eliminate corrosion from metallic surfaces using directed light energy varies significantly depending on factors such as power, features, and manufacturer. For instance, a compact, lower-power system suitable for small-scale applications will typically have a lower acquisition cost than a high-powered, industrial-grade model designed for heavy-duty use.
Understanding the financial investment required for this technology is crucial for businesses and individuals seeking effective corrosion mitigation solutions. Evaluating the initial expenditure alongside potential long-term savings from reduced labor, material replacement, and chemical use provides a complete picture of the return on investment. Historically, rust removal has relied on abrasive methods, often damaging the underlying material. The advent of light-based solutions offers a precise, non-destructive approach, although the initial investment can be higher.
